Stephen Shepherd is an experienced actuary currently serving as a Pricing and Portfolio Management Actuary at Lancashire Insurance Group since November 2020. Prior roles include Pricing Actuary at AmTrust at Lloyd's from November 2017 to October 2020 and Commercial Pricing Analyst at AXA Commercial Lines from November 2013 to November 2017. Additionally, Stephen held positions as an Actuarial Analyst at Capita and Towers Watson, and an Associate at Fidelity Worldwide Investment. Stephen holds a Master of Mathematics degree from Southampton University, obtained between 2005 and 2009, and completed secondary education at Overton Grange School from 1997 to 2005.
Sign up to view 0 direct reports
Get started